INSTRUCTIONS FOR EASEMENT COMPLETION

 

  1. You must have legal description of property as it appears on your deed or abstract.  The description on your tax statement will not work.

 

  1. The name of the person(s) signing must be typed below the signature line.  The typed name must match the signature.  If the person signing is married, the spouse must also sign.

 

  1. If land is being purchased on Contract for Deed, the seller(s) and buyer(s) name(s) must be typed on the easement form and seller(s) and buyer(s) must sign the easement in the presence of a notary public.

 

  1. If multiple signatures are required and all parties cannot sign in the presence of a notary at the same time, the notary must use a separate acknowledgement.  These are available either at the recorders office or from North Star Electric’s office or website (www.northstarelectric.coop)  .

 

  1. Corporations signing an easement require a corporate easement which is different from the regular one.  These are available at the North Star office or website.

 

  1. The notary MUST state in the acknowledgement the marital status of the persons signing the easement.

 

 

Please return the easement to North Star Electric along with a check for $46.00 made out to the Recorders Office for the county that the property is located in.
